Islamabad (Staff Reporter) There is no shortage of talent in the young generation, the need is to provide more opportunities to develop and encourage the hidden talents of the youth, for the development of the country. “Entrepreneurship should be encouraged” These views were expressed by the Vice Chancellor of Allama Iqbal Open University, Prof. Dr. Nasir Mehmood while addressing the ceremony of awarding prizes and certificates to the students who presented the best brainstorming ideas in entrepreneurship activities. Dr. Nasir Mehmood said that it is the era of skills and knowledge economy, the countries around us made valuable products by making amazing use of used plastic, which improved their economy and went far ahead of us. Young people have skills, innovation requires thinking, the young generation has to think about what the world needs and how we can make it. Describing the services, he said that 100 applications were received for the ‘Big Ideas Competition 2021’ in which 18 students were shortlisted, the ideas of five students were declared as the best business ideas which are being awarded today. Additional Director Research, Dr. Saima. Nasir also addressed the ceremony. At the end of the ceremony, Vice Chancellor, Prof. Dr. Nasir Mahmood distributed prizes and certificates to the students who presented the best ideas.
